8. Commercial Placements and Aggregated Metrics
HustlX may show labeled sponsor, partner, house, or ad placements on surfaces such as league pages, match pages, official profiles, official programs, courts, trainings, and related management tools. In the current implementation, commercial delivery is contextual, not behavioral: placements are selected based on surface, placement slot, organization, league, match, court, official profile, or similar public operating context, not by building private interest profiles about individual users.
We may record aggregated impression and click metrics for commercial placements, including placement identifiers, creative identifiers, public context, surface, event type, and coarse timing. These metrics help sponsors, advertisers, organizers, and HustlX understand whether a placement loaded or was clicked. We do not provide sponsors with private contact details or individual profile-level targeting data as part of this v1 commercial placement system.
Commercial categories that may be sensitive for youth sports, regulated products, political messaging, gambling-adjacent services, medical or supplement claims, financial offers, contests, or similar promotions may require additional review or may be blocked pending legal or platform approval.
9. Sharing of Information
We do not sell personal data. We may share data with trusted service providers and processors that support hosting, backend operations, authentication, file storage, security, analytics, mapping, realtime notifications, and customer support under confidentiality and data protection controls.
Based on the current platform configuration, these services may include S3-compatible object storage for uploads, Ably for realtime notifications, PostHog for analytics, and Google services for authentication or map or location-related features when those features are used or enabled.
We may also disclose personal data to organization admins, coaches, team managers, league or training organizers, and other participants when reasonably necessary to operate the platform and the competitions or programs you join, as well as to regulators, law enforcement, or professional advisers when required by law or needed to protect rights and security.
